What We Treat as a Dental Emergency

A dental emergency is any situation involving severe oral pain, infection risk, or structural damage that requires urgent professional attention.   • 🦷
    Severe Toothache

    Intense, throbbing pain that doesn't subside is typically caused by irreversible pulpitis (nerve infection) requiring root canal treatment or extraction. We eliminate the pain in a single visit.

  • 💔
    Cracked or Broken Tooth

    A fractured tooth exposes the nerve and is extremely painful. Depending on severity, we restore it with a filling, crown, or if necessary, an extraction.

  • 🦠
    Dental Abscess & Facial Swelling

    A dental abscess is a bacterial infection forming a pus-filled pocket around a tooth root. Facial swelling with fever is a medical emergency — the infection can spread rapidly to the jaw, neck, and beyond. Requires immediate drainage, antibiotics, and root canal treatment.

  • 👑
    Lost Crown or Filling

    A lost crown or filling exposes the sensitive inner dentin of the tooth to temperature and bacteria. We replace crowns and rebuild fillings urgently to protect the tooth.

  • 🦷
    Knocked-Out Tooth

    A knocked-out permanent tooth can potentially be saved if you reach us within 30-60 minutes. Store the tooth in milk or saliva (under your tongue) and come in immediately.

  • 🩸
    Uncontrolled Bleeding After Extraction

    Some bleeding after a tooth extraction is normal, but persistent heavy bleeding after 30-45 minutes requires immediate attention. We apply haemostatic agents to stop the bleeding.

First Aid While You Travel to Us

  1. Take ibuprofen (400mg) or paracetamol for immediate pain relief. Do not place aspirin directly on the tooth or gums.
  2. Rinse with warm salt water to reduce bacteria and soothe inflamed gums.
  3. Apply clove oil (eugenol) on a cotton ball to the painful tooth for temporary numbing.
  4. If a crown has fallen off, try to reattach it temporarily with dental wax, sugar-free gum, or even toothpaste — then come see us immediately.
  5. Apply cold compress (ice pack outside the cheek) for facial swelling. Never apply heat to a swollen face.

Mild sensitivity can sometimes resolve. But severe, persistent toothache almost never resolves without treatment. If the pain briefly stops after being very severe, it often means the nerve has died — but infection is still spreading. See a dentist immediately regardless.

Yes, a dental abscess is a serious bacterial infection. Left untreated, the infection can spread to the jaw, neck, and in severe cases, to the brain or bloodstream (sepsis). Facial swelling with fever is a medical emergency. WhatsApp us immediately.
